District-Level ASHA Convention 2025–26 Successfully Held in Bongaigaon

Bongaigaon, March 10: The District Health Society, Bongaigaon, under the National Health Mission (NHM), successfully organised the District-Level ASHA Convention 2025–26 on March 10 at Barpara Public Field.

The programme aimed to recognise the dedicated services of ASHA workers and strengthen community health initiatives across the district. Bongaigaon Deputy Commissioner Dibakar Nath attended the event as the Chief Guest, while the programme was presided over by Dr. Gopal Ch. Ray, Joint Director of Health Services.

Speaking on the occasion, the dignitaries highlighted the crucial role played by ASHA workers and supervisors in strengthening grassroots healthcare services and improving maternal and child health indicators in the district.

Several health officials were present at the event, including District Surveillance Officer Dr. B. Ch. Sarkar, SDM&HO (School Health) Dr. H. D. Sarkar, SDM&HO (North Salmara) Dr. Mustafijur Rahman, SDM&HO (Srijangram) Dr. B. B. Medhi, SDM&HO (Bongaigaon) Dr. A. Saraniya, and SDM&HO (Mankapur) Dr. Kalyan Ray, along with other officials and healthcare workers.

During the programme, ASHA workers shared their experiences and contributions towards improving community healthcare services. Appreciation certificates and mementos were distributed to all ASHA workers in recognition of their efforts. The “ASHA Kiran” cheque distribution programme was also conducted to provide death benefits and support to the families of ASHA workers.

The event also featured a felicitation ceremony for the Greater Bongaigaon Press Club for its support in disseminating health-related information to the public. Additionally, NQAS-certified AMAs (Ayushman Arogya Mandirs) were felicitated for achieving quality standards in healthcare services.

The convention included cultural performances and a comedy programme presented by ASHA workers, showcasing their talents beyond healthcare services. The event concluded with a musical performance by Sagarika Pathak, BCM of Srijangram.

Health department officials expressed appreciation for the continuous dedication of ASHA workers, acknowledging their vital role in strengthening the public health system and improving community health across Bongaigaon district.
